Data Basics

Data is the heart of FPET and it is important that you understand the different types of data that FPET uses, how they differ, and what they can and cannot tell us about family planning services and programs. The model combines population data, survey data, and service statistics (when input by the user) to calculate annual estimates of contraceptive prevalence, unmet need and demand for family planning satisfied by conraceptive methods.
